Common Uninstall Content Anywhere.exe Errors on Windows

Encountering errors associated with Uninstall Content Anywhere.exe can be frustrating. These errors may vary in nature and can surface due to different reasons, such as software conflicts, outdated drivers, or even malware infections. Below, we've outlined the most commonly reported errors linked to Uninstall Content Anywhere.exe, to aid in understanding and potentially resolving the issues at hand.

  • Uninstall Content Anywhere.exe File Not Executing: This warning appears when the executable file fails to launch as expected. Reasons could include damaged file data, improper file permissions, or insufficient system resources.
  • Missing Uninstall Content Anywhere.exe File: This alert comes up when the system is unable to locate the necessary executable file. Uninstall Content Anywhere.exe could have been removed, relocated, or the provided file path might be incorrect.
  • Error 0xc0000005: Also known as Access Violation Error, it happens when the application tries to access the location of the memory that is already used by another .exe file, which results in a conflict.
  • Uninstall Content Anywhere.exe Application Error: This error message indicates a problem encountered by the executable application during its execution. This could be due to software bugs, corrupted files, or conflicts with other programs.
  • Not a Valid Win32 Application: This error typically occurs when the user tries to execute a program that is not compatible with their version of Windows or when the file is corrupted or incomplete.

Step 1: Open the Command Prompt

Step 1: Open the Command Prompt Thumbnail
  1. Press the Windows key.

  2. Type Command Prompt in the search bar and press Enter.

  3. Right-click on Command Prompt and select Run as administrator.

Step 2: Run Check Disk Utility

Step 2: Run Check Disk Utility Thumbnail
  1. In the Command Prompt window, type chkdsk /f and press Enter.

  2. If the system reports that it cannot run the check because the disk is in use, type Y and press Enter to schedule the check for the next system restart.

Step 3: Restart Your Computer

Step 3: Restart Your Computer Thumbnail
  1. If you had to schedule the check, restart your computer for the check to be performed.
